Employee Seriously Injured from Pallet Jack

On February 25, 2011, Employee #1 was picking merchandise ina store room, the pallet jack was positioned so Employee #1 could not remove the necessary product. Standing on the floor, Employee #1 began to move the pallet jack towards him, when the handle abruptly jerked to his left, and into metal racking. Employee #1's left ankle was pinned between the pallet jack and the base of a metal rack, which also included the pallet jack coming onto his foot. Employee #1 sustained a shattered left ankle with a large hole just above the ankle. Surgery was performed to insert a plate with screws into the ankle and to sew up the hole.
